Output faa5859bc46cb5d3031ec7b20b2fdd6a579d8811c5016a2060222d20b7640a22:1

value
2182
script pubkey
OP_0 OP_PUSHBYTES_20 efc24be3b93f2ecf7fbff1fe4ed361fd1d00346b
address
bc1qalpyhcae8uhv7lal78lya5mpl5wsqdrtrlzn2m
transaction
faa5859bc46cb5d3031ec7b20b2fdd6a579d8811c5016a2060222d20b7640a22
confirmations
144336
spent
true